What is KoboCollect?

KoboCollect is a free Android application that turns a smartphone or tablet into a field‑ready data‑entry device. It is designed to work with the KoboToolbox platform, a popular suite of tools for creating, managing, and analysing surveys in humanitarian, development, and research projects.

Main capabilities

  • Offline data capture – Record responses without an internet connection and upload them later.
  • Support for multimedia – Attach photos, audio, or video to individual survey items.
  • Unlimited forms – Load as many questionnaires as you need; the app does not impose a hard limit on the number of forms or submissions stored locally.
  • Secure storage – Data is kept on the device until you choose to sync, giving you control over when it leaves the field.

How it works

Before you can start collecting, you need a free KoboToolbox account. After logging in on the web, you create a survey (called a “form”) using the KoboToolbox form builder. Once the form is published, you configure KoboCollect with the account credentials and the URL of the form. The app then downloads the form definition to the device.

When you are in the field, open KoboCollect, select the desired form, and begin entering responses. The interface follows a simple question‑by‑question flow, supporting multiple‑choice, numeric, text, and GPS location inputs. After completing a submission, you can review it, edit if necessary, and save it locally. When you have network access, a single tap synchronises all pending submissions with your KoboToolbox project.

Practical uses

KoboCollect is especially useful in situations where reliable internet is unavailable or costly. Typical scenarios include:

  1. Humanitarian emergencies where rapid needs assessments are required.
  2. Rural development surveys in remote villages.
  3. Environmental monitoring that involves field observations and photo documentation.
  4. Academic research that gathers primary data from participants in the field.

Installation notes

The app is distributed through the Google Play Store. Install it like any other Android application, then launch it to begin the initial setup. Because the app stores data locally, ensure the device has sufficient free storage for the expected volume of submissions, especially if you plan to capture images or audio.

Things to keep in mind

  • You must have an active KoboToolbox account; the app does not create accounts on its own.
  • Data is only uploaded when you manually trigger a sync, so remember to connect to the internet periodically.
  • The app inherits its user interface from the open‑source ODK Collect project, so users familiar with ODK will find the navigation intuitive.

Frequently asked questions

Do I need an internet connection to use KoboCollect?

No. The app is built for offline work. You only need connectivity to download new forms or to upload completed submissions.

Can I use my own KoboToolbox server?

Yes. Advanced users can point KoboCollect to a self‑hosted KoboToolbox instance by entering the appropriate server URL during configuration.

Is there a limit to the number of photos I can attach?

The app does not impose a hard limit, but the practical limit is the available storage on your device.

Is KoboCollect free?

Yes. Both the Android app and the core KoboToolbox services are offered at no cost.
